The Mlabri people of Thailand are known for weaving Yellow Leaf Hammocks, which are an excellent choice for these kinds of predicaments. Rachel Connors and Joe Demin, the company’s founders, presented their invention on Shark Tank and secured a business partnership with Daniel Lubetzky.

Appearance On The Shark Tank

In 2019, Joe and Rachel were guests on Shark Tank for the eleventh season. They proposed an exchange of $400,000 in return for a 7% ownership part of their business. The entrepreneurs then proceeded to brief the investors on the goals they hoped to accomplish as well as the specifics of their hammock products.

Daniel Lubetzky, a billionaire, was impressed with the product and offered them the money in exchange for 33% of the company’s shares. Additionally interested were Lori Greiner and Robert Herjavec, who consequently came up with their own rates.

Because the three potential investors were so anxious to put their money into the hammock manufacturing business, they kept shifting the terms of their bids. It came to an end when Daniel made an offer of $1 million in exchange for 25% of the company’s shares, which the entrepreneurs were unable to refuse.

What Happened After Shark Tank?

Before appearing on Shark Tank, Joe and Rachel were working with Virgin Cruise Lines to handle their international business. In addition, the business transaction that took place between the company’s founders and Daniel Lubetzky proved fruitful. The celebrity investor expressed his excitement to assist the young company in a very public way.

However, they were severely impacted by the pandemic, as a result of which the company’s cruise ship sales reached an all-time low. This was due to the fact that mobility inside and between each country was severely restricted.
